The Addsion 9.5+/- offers a great opportunity for a family homestead, rural get away, or small recreational acreage.
Property is accessed via paved Co. Rd 41 and has power at the road frontage and a water meter currently in place. Kemp Branch dissects the tract east to west and provides year-round enjoyment of a rock bottom stream.
Topography varies, and the tract has several nice spots for a future private homesite tucked away from the road frontage. Timber make up reminds one of Bankhead National Forest (located 1/4 mile west as the crow flies). A majority of the property is a young hardwood stand with various species of oaks, hickories, and poplar. There are a couple of nice pine ridges overlooking hardwood bottoms. Understory is clean and clear with long sight lines and easy hiking and walking.
